How many guests are you having? Think about the amount of space they will need in order to have room to sign and then work backwards.
I'd also take a look at some websites, the craft store (for both frame mat inspiration and the wedding section for pre-made ones), etc to see how large most of the ones that exist out there are, and to get an idea for how many signatures you want to collect.

The one that they are selling on this website is 16x20 and if I had to guess that would probably hold around 100 signatures/well wishes. Perhaps you could make something that's 20x20 or so?
If you live close to a wedding shop, perhaps you could ask to look at the signature mats and then ask them what the specs are for their mats and how many signatures they hold and from there create your own with the exact measurements you get from the store. They also sell a sign-able mat at Michaels for 8.99 - and the frame size is 20x20 and the picture size is 5x7!

We had a mat custom made for our wedding with the wedding colors. The picture inside is 8x10 and the frame is 16x20. We had about 30 guests come to the wedding and the size was pretty good for that amount!
The guests don't really take up that much space. I think the Michael's one should be fine if you're on a budget.
